Oracle时间戳转换日期

一、Oracle时间戳转换日期格式

Oracle中时间戳类型为TIMESTAMP,其格式为:YYYY-MM-DD HH24:MI:SS.FF,其中 FF 表示毫秒,范围为 000000 – 999999。

使用TO_CHAR函数可以将时间戳转换为指定格式的日期字符串,具体代码如下:

SELECT TO_CHAR(SYSTIMESTAMP, 'YYYY-MM-DD HH24:MI:SS.FF') FROM DUAL;

运行结果如下:

2021-10-26 18:17:21.297555

二、Oracle时间戳转换日期毫秒

Oracle中时间戳类型包含毫秒,可以使用EXTRACT函数将毫秒提取出来,具体代码如下:

SELECT EXTRACT(MILLISECOND FROM SYSTIMESTAMP) FROM DUAL;

运行结果如下:

297

三、Oracle时间戳转换日期格式 毫秒

将时间戳转换为指定格式的日期字符串时,可以使用FF参数表示毫秒。具体代码如下:

SELECT TO_CHAR(SYSTIMESTAMP, 'YYYY-MM-DD HH24:MI:SS.FF3') FROM DUAL;

运行结果如下:

2021-10-26 18:17:21.297

四、Oracle时间戳转换日期格式sql

如果需要将时间戳转换为指定格式的日期字符串作为SQL语句的一部分,可以使用如下代码:

SELECT * FROM MY_TABLE WHERE CREATE_TIME = TO_DATE('2021-10-26 18:17:21.297', 'YYYY-MM-DD HH24:MI:SS.FF3');

五、Oracle将时间戳转换为日期

使用TO_DATE函数可以将时间戳转换为日期类型,具体代码如下:

SELECT TO_DATE('2021-10-26 18:17:21.297', 'YYYY-MM-DD HH24:MI:SS.FF3') FROM DUAL;

运行结果如下:

2021-10-26 18:17:21

六、Oracle时间戳转换成时间

使用TO_TIMESTAMP函数可以将字符串类型转换为时间戳类型,具体代码如下:

SELECT TO_TIMESTAMP('2021-10-26 18:17:21', 'YYYY-MM-DD HH24:MI:SS') FROM DUAL;

运行结果如下:

2021-10-26 18:17:21

七、Oracle日期转换成数字

使用TO_NUMBER函数可以将日期类型转换为数字类型,具体代码如下:

SELECT TO_NUMBER(TO_CHAR(SYSDATE, 'YYYYMMDD')) FROM DUAL;

运行结果如下:

20211026

八、Oracle时间戳转换数字

使用CAST函数可以将时间戳类型转换为数字类型,具体代码如下:

SELECT CAST(SYSTIMESTAMP AS DATE) FROM DUAL;

运行结果如下:

2021-10-26 18:17:21

九、Oracle查询时间戳

使用SYSTIMESTAMP关键字可以查询当前系统时间戳,具体代码如下:

SELECT SYSTIMESTAMP FROM DUAL;

运行结果如下:

2021-10-26 18:17:21.297555

原创文章,作者:小蓝,如若转载,请注明出处:https://www.506064.com/n/302960.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
小蓝小蓝
上一篇 2024-12-31 11:48
下一篇 2024-12-31 11:48

相关推荐

  • Python计算阳历日期对应周几

    本文介绍如何通过Python计算任意阳历日期对应周几。 一、获取日期 获取日期可以通过Python内置的模块datetime实现,示例代码如下: from datetime imp…

    编程 2025-04-29
  • 如何将Oracle索引变成另一个表?

    如果你需要将一个Oracle索引导入到另一个表中,可以按照以下步骤来完成这个过程。 一、创建目标表 首先,需要在数据库中创建一个新的表格,用来存放索引数据。可以通过以下代码创建一个…

    编程 2025-04-29
  • 解决docker-compose 容器时间和服务器时间不同步问题

    docker-compose是一种工具,能够让您使用YAML文件来定义和运行多个容器。然而,有时候容器的时间与服务器时间不同步,导致一些不必要的错误和麻烦。以下是解决方法的详细介绍…

    编程 2025-04-29
  • Python获取当前日期的多种方法

    本文介绍如何使用Python获取当前日期,并提供了多种方法,包括使用datetime模块、time模块以及第三方库dateutil等。让我们一步一步来看。 一、使用datetime…

    编程 2025-04-29
  • Python按照日期画折线图

    本文将为您详细介绍如何使用Python按照日期(时间)来画折线图。 一、准备工作 首先,我们需要安装Matplotlib包,该包提供了各种绘图函数,包括折线图、柱形图、散点图等等。…

    编程 2025-04-28
  • 想把你和时间藏起来

    如果你觉得时间过得太快,每天都过得太匆忙,那么你是否曾经想过想把时间藏起来,慢慢享受每一个瞬间?在这篇文章中,我们将会从多个方面,详细地阐述如何想把你和时间藏起来。 一、一些时间管…

    编程 2025-04-28
  • 计算斐波那契数列的时间复杂度解析

    斐波那契数列是一个数列,其中每个数都是前两个数的和,第一个数和第二个数都是1。斐波那契数列的前几项为:1,1,2,3,5,8,13,21,34,…。计算斐波那契数列常用…

    编程 2025-04-28
  • 时间戳秒级可以用int吗

    时间戳是指从某个固定的时间点开始计算的已经过去的时间。在计算机领域,时间戳通常使用秒级或毫秒级来表示。在实际使用中,我们经常会遇到需要将时间戳转换为整数类型的情况。那么,时间戳秒级…

    编程 2025-04-28
  • 如何在ACM竞赛中优化开发时间

    ACM竞赛旨在提高程序员的算法能力和解决问题的实力,然而在比赛中优化开发时间同样至关重要。 一、规划赛前准备 1、提前熟悉比赛规则和题目类型,了解常见算法、数据结构和快速编写代码的…

    编程 2025-04-28
  • Python如何输入日期

    Python是一种非常流行的编程语言,它可以让开发人员轻松地处理日期时间。在本文中,我们将详细介绍Python如何输入日期的方法,无论您是在处理日期时间的数据分析还是在创建Web应…

    编程 2025-04-28

发表回复

登录后才能评论